Accomplished Musician,
Passionate Educator

With a Bachelor of Music (Honours) in French Horn from the Queensland Conservatorium Griffith University (QCGU), I have honed my skills under the guidance of esteemed padagogues and musicians Peter Luff, Ysolt Clark, and Malcolm Stuart. During my studies, I was honored to receive both academic and performance awards, recognizing my dedication and achievements.

How it All Began

When my primary school music teacher discovered that I have perfect pitch, she suggested I take up the French horn. Initially drawn to its shine and curviness, the more I played, the deeper my love grew for the instrument's unique challenges. The dedicated and passionate teachers who nurtured my journey have profoundly shaped my own teaching approach to be engaging, informative, and tailored to match each student's intellectual pace.

Masterclasses & International Activity

I have had the honor of participating in masterclasses led by distinguished horn players like Stefan Dohr, Sarah Willis, Andrew Bain, and Nobuaki Fukukawa. As a member of QHorns, the resident horn ensemble at QCGU, I traveled to Brazil, performing at the International Horn Symposium in 2017. My involvement with the Australian Youth Orchestra (AYO) International Tour allowed me to perform in renowned concert halls across China, Europe, and Australia, including the iconic Het Concertgebouw and the Sydney Opera House. In 2018, I was awarded the AYO Accenture Scholarship, enabling me to travel to Germany and receive lessons from respected horn pedagogues and musicians, such as Marie Louise Neunecker, Ab Koster, Markus Maskuniitty, Jörg Brückner, and Szabolcs Zempleni.

Professional Highlights

I have performed as a casual musician with orchestras and ensembles including the Queensland Symphony Orchestra, Adelaide Symphony Orchestra, Queensland Camerata, and Queensland Pops Orchestra. One of my most memorable performances was my first professional gig, which was with Hans Zimmer in Brisbane during his world tour!
